Since it was formed in 1973, the BBC Midland Radio Orchestra has achieved great status in the world of popular music. The Orchestra now contributes some seventy tunes every week to Radio Two prgrammes. As well as having its own Saturday evening programme, the M.R.O. can be heard seven days a week somewhere on Radio Two. On this, the Orchestra's fourth L.P., under the expert musical direction of its resident conductor, norriw paramor, our attention is focused on the cinema and some of the great music that has been composed for the 'big' screen. The M.R.O. brings its own style to fourteen favourite themes that cover twenty years or so of movie-making. "Secret Love" which featured in the film "Calamity Jane" takes us back to 1953. The theme "Love Said Goodbye" from "Godfathe II" brings us right up to date, to 1975. Westerns, gangsters, musical comedies, detechive thrillers are represented. Included on the record is "The Frightened City" which Norrie composed for the film of the same name in 1961. The Orchestra also plays "More Than Ever Now", the haunting theme from the 1971 film "The Railway Children", composed by John Douglas. John has been responsible for many of the M.R.O.'s superb orchestrations that are fun to playand so popular with Radio Two listeners. We hope that you will find enjoyment in listening to this, the Orchestr'a latest offering. It is the kind of music that you can hear from Norrie Paramor and the Midland Radio Orchestra, as we said, any day of the week, somewhere on Radio Two. David Welsby BBC Birmingham | ||

BBC Radio Enterprises Ltd and BBC Enterprises Ltd, predecessors of BBC Worldwide / BBC Worldwide Ltd., the BBC's commercial arm. Formed 1968 and 1979 respectively, they were a subsidiary wholly owned by the BBC and merged into BBC Worldwide in 1995. In that time, there were companies set up within or structured brands as part of the company to deal with separate parts of the business, e.g. BBC Records for recorded audio. Sometimes written as BBC Enterprise Ltd.
